The Spectrum of Hacking: Understanding Your Hire
Before looking for out a professional, it is important to understand the differences in between the different classifications of hackers. The cybersecurity world typically classifies practitioners into three "hats" based on their intent and legality.
Kind of HackerIntentLegalityRole in BusinessWhite-HatEthical & & Protective Legal & Contractual Identifies and fixes vulnerabilities with consent. Grey-Hat Ambiguous Frequently Illegal Finds defects without authorization however typically reportsthem instead of exploiting them for harm. Black-Hat Malicious& ExploitativeIllegal Unapproved access for financial gain, espionage, or interruption. For a service, the focus is solely onWhite-Hathackers. These are specialists who operate under strict legalagreements and ethical guidelines to carry out security audits.
Core Services Offered by Experienced Ethical Hackers An experienced expert brings a diverse toolkit to the table. Their objective is to imitate a real-world attack to see how well an organization
's defenses hold up. Below are the primary services these professionals offer: 1. Penetration Testing(Pen Testing) This is an organized attempt to breach a company's security systems. It includes testing network borders, web applications, and physical security steps to see where a destructive actor may discover anentry point. 2. Vulnerability Assessments Unlike a full-blown pen test, a vulnerability evaluation is a top-level scan of the digital environment to identify recognized security weak points without always exploiting them. 3. Social Engineering Tests Often, the weakest link in security is the human component. Ethical hackers carry out simulated phishing attacks or"vishing"(voice phishing)to train workers on how to spot and prevent adjustment by cybercriminals. 4. Cloud Security Audits As more organizations move to the cloud(AWS, Azure, Google Cloud ), protecting
these environments becomes complex. Experts ensure that cloud configurations are airtight which information is encrypted both at rest and in transit. The Process of a Professional Security Engagement When a company hires a knowledgeable ethical hacker, the process follows a structured method to guarantee safety and efficiency. Scope Definition: The hacker and the client concur on what systems will betested, what methods are off-limits, and the timeframe for the engagement. Reconnaissance: The hacker collects details about the target using openly offered tools and data (OSINT) to draw up the attack surface.Scanning and Analysis: Using technical tools, they recognize active ports, services, and prospective vulnerabilities. Exploitation: With permission, the hacker tries to exploit the vulnerabilities to determinethe level of gain access to they can achieve. Reporting: This is the most vital phase. The professional provides an in-depth report detailing the findings, the severity of each risk, and prioritized recommendations for remediation. Remediation and Re-testing: After business fixes the concerns, the hacker frequently carries outa follow-up test to ensure the patches are efficient. Identifying Top-Tier Talent: Certifications to Look For Because the title"hacker"is unregulated, organizations need to depend on market certifications and recorded experience to verify the competence of their hire. Secret Professional Certifications: OSCP (Offensive Security Certified Professional): Known for its strenuous 24-hour useful test, this is the gold standard for penetration screening. CEH(Certified Ethical Hacker): Providesa broad understanding of hacking tools and methods. CISSP( Certified Information Systems Security Professional): Focuses on top-level security management andarchitecture. GPEN(GIAC Penetration Tester): Validates a professional's capability to conduct tasks as part of an official security audit. The length of time does a common engagement take? A basic penetration test can take anywhere from one to 3 weeks, depending on the complexity of the network and the number of applications being evaluated.
